There was a 20m  Drake net a few yrs ago, started back at the same time
the 40m one was, by John Loughmiller, KB9AT.  It petered out due to lack
of participation.  Propagation was such that it was difficult to get all
stations hearing each other, fills, relays, etc. were common.  For a while
a Brazilian stn was trying to hold it together, don't remember his call.
Time of day may have been a problem, don't remember just when it was.
